Praia do Tofo
Tofo Beach- a beautiful coastal fishing village in southeastern Mozambique. About a six hour drive from Maputo, this is one of my favorite beaches of all time.

Diving and surfing are the main attractions- If you are fortunate enough to find yourself in Tofo, I recommend staying at Turtle Cove. Make sure to check out Dino’s Beach Bar and try the local rum.
